Cellulose incorporates a large concentration of recycled product, which makes it an attractive eco-friendly alternative. The material is dealt with to resist insects and help it become flame-retardant, although the chemical treatment plans may emit VOCs. Cellulose also results in being incredibly large When you have a h2o leak mainly because it absorbs dampness.

When the common two-motor vehicle garage might be comparatively inexpensive to insulate, lots of property insulation corporations Have a very bare minimum charge so you might want to contain the garage as section of a larger project. The standard Value to insulate a two-car or truck garage is $0.50 to $1.twenty five per sq. foot, which doesn't involve the garage doorway.
